I think what you want is to use wildcards.
LinkedHashSet extends ThatType> someFunction(LinkedHashSet extends ThatType> set) {
return set;
}
As has been explained elsewhere LinkedHashSet is not a subclass of LinkedHashSet, since LinkedHashSet can't accept ThatType objects.
The wildcard in LinkedHashSet extends ThatType> means a LinkedHastSet of some class (not sure what) that extends ThatType.
Though you may want to consider using this:
Set extends ThatType> someFunction(Set extends ThatType> set) {
return set;
}
